WebTo execute a hostnamectl command on a remote system, use the -H, --host option as follows: ~]# hostnamectl set-hostname -H [username]@hostname Where hostname is the remote host you want to configure. The username is optional. The hostnamectl tool will use SSH to connect to the remote system. Web11. Bash stores its list of aliases in the associative array BASH_ALIASES. The equivalent of sudo `alias netstat` is then sudo $ {BASH_ALIASES [netstat]}. However, I would … bollywood unplugged songs https://ucayalilogistica.com

As stated already, the … Webfind . -type f -name '*.txt' xargs rm . The rm is passed as a simple string argument to xargs and is later invoked by xargs without alias substitution of the shell. You alias is probably defined in ~/.bashrc, in case you want to remove it. you can use this simple command to solve your problem. find . -type f -name '*.txt' -delete

This will create an alias called home which will put you in the /home/dave/public_html directory … bollywood unwind sessionWeb16 nov. 2024 · In addition to parameter aliases, PowerShell lets you specify the parameter name using the fewest characters needed to uniquely identify the parameter. For example, the Get-ChildItem cmdlet has the Recurse and ReadOnly parameters. To uniquely identify the Recurse parameter you only need to provide -rec.
